Questions about this program

How big is the program signal?

Area Studies accounts for 0.3% of reported programs at Indiana University-Bloomington, which is bigger than 50% of schools in this field set and below the national average concentration. The enrollment proxy is about 110 students when that share is applied to current enrollment.

How should I read the cost number?

Indiana University-Bloomington's average net price is $16,264 per year, about $65,056 over four years. That is $5,329 below the $21,593 peer average, before your own aid package changes the final bill.

Are the earnings major-specific?

No. The $63,742 median earnings figure is school-wide ten years after entry. It is $1,708 below the $65,450 average among schools reporting this field, so treat it as an outcomes proxy rather than a department guarantee.
